Inès Arouaissa (Arabic: إيناس أرويسة;[5] born 30 June 2001) is a footballer who plays as a goalkeeper for Division 2 Féminine club Olympique de Marseille. Born in France, she represents Morocco at international level.

Club career

Arouaissa is a Marseille product, which she joined in 2016.[1]

International career

Arouaissa made her senior debut for Morocco on 10 June 2021 in a 3–0 friendly home win over Mali.[3]
